What's inside
Six things every institute keeps track of
Students & teachers
One roll for the institute. Being on it doesn't mean having a login — most students never need one.
Classes & subjects
Who teaches what, and who sits in it. A student can be in several classes; a teacher can run several at once.
Materials
Upload once, publish to the classes that need it. Update the file and everyone has the new version.
Exams
Build a paper, freeze it, publish it. Students sit it online and it scores itself against the version they were given.
Attendance
Marked against the session, not the day. See a term's record without adding up a register by hand.
Fees
What's due, what's paid, who's behind — the question every institute owner asks first.

Questions
Before you ask
Why not just keep using WhatsApp?+
A group chat has no memory. You can't answer "was Ashen here last Tuesday", "did this student pay for March", or "who has the latest paper" without scrolling. Gradow keeps the answers instead of the conversation.
Do students and parents need accounts?+
Only if you want them to. Everyone on your roll exists in Gradow whether or not they ever log in — you can run the whole institute without inviting a single student.
What happens to our data if we leave?+
It's yours. Export it whenever you want, and nothing is held back to make leaving harder.
Can another institute see our students?+
No. Each institute's data is isolated at the database level, not merely hidden in the interface. A teacher who works at two institutes sees them separately, never both at once.
